Location and Accessibility: Melvern Lake's South Shore

Blackjack Campground is strategically positioned on the south side of Melvern Lake within the boundaries of Eisenhower State Park. The location offers excellent access to the lake and its recreational amenities. The park is easily reachable from major routes in eastern Kansas, making it a convenient destination from Topeka, Lawrence, and the Wichita area.

The address is given as an Unnamed Road near Lebo, KS 66856, USA. For navigation purposes, campers typically follow signage to Eisenhower State Park, which is located near the town of Osage City, and then follow internal park signage to the Blackjack Campground loop. The campground is part of the extensive park system that covers 1,785 acres of land surrounding the 7,000-acre Melvern Lake. Its lakeside setting provides stunning views and immediate access to water-based fun, while the surrounding area captures the beautiful, native tallgrass prairie scenery of the Flint Hills region. The park’s infrastructure ensures that the area, while rustic, is easily accessible to standard passenger vehicles.

Services Offered at Blackjack Campground

While Blackjack Campground is designated for non-utility or "primitive" camping, it still offers significant support facilities that elevate the user experience, exceeding what one might expect from a basic camping area.

  • Campsite Type: Designated sites for tent camping are available. While most sites are primitive, some non-utility sites in the park are often available for a walk-up reservation basis.
  • Modern Restrooms: A key highlight is the presence of very well-kept, clean bathrooms with flush toilets and sinks.
  • Shower Facilities: Campers have access to shower houses, a highly valued amenity that ensures comfort after a day of swimming or hiking.
  • Drinking Water: Potable drinking water is readily available within the campground area.
  • Site Furnishings: Individual sites are equipped with picnic tables and fire rings or grills for outdoor cooking and gatherings.
  • Shared Facilities Access: Campers at Blackjack have access to the numerous park amenities, including a nearby sanitary dump station for self-contained RVs, though the sites themselves do not have hookups.

Features and Highlights: Trails, Lake Access, and Wildlife

Blackjack Campground's location within Eisenhower State Park is its greatest asset, offering a vast array of recreational features for Kansas outdoor enthusiasts.

  • Direct Lake Access: The campground's location provides easy access to Melvern Lake for boating, swimming (at designated beaches within the park), and excellent fishing opportunities for species like walleye, crappie, and channel catfish.
  • Extensive Trail System: The park is home to a burgeoning trail system, including hiking, biking, and equestrian trails like the 20-mile Crooked Knee Horse Trail. The trailhead for the bike and archery trail is also located nearby in the Five-Star campground loop.
  • Family Amenities: The park features a playground, a basketball court, and horseshoe pits within the adjacent Jones Family Activity Area, making it a perfect spot for families.
  • Disc Golf: An 18-hole disc golf course is available near the east boat ramp, providing a fun and active outdoor pursuit.
  • Wildlife Viewing: The preserve is home to white-tailed deer, wild turkey, bobwhite quail, and various furbearers, offering fantastic opportunities for nature watching and environmental education.
  • Historical Significance: The park is named after President Dwight D. Eisenhower, providing a cultural touchstone to the state's most famous resident.
